What is Blast Furnace Slag and How to Process It?

Blast furnace slag can be processed into the following materials by various processes. In China, blast furnace slag is usually processed into water slag, slag gravel, expanded slag and slag beads.Water slag is the process of putting the hot-melt blast furnace slag into water for rapid cooling, which mainly includes slag pool water …

Generation, utilization, and environmental impact of ladle furnace slag …

However, most ladle furnace slag already contains multiple heavy metals, such as Cr, Mn, V, W, and Mo. Research has shown that the leaching concentrations of some heavy metals in some types of ladle furnace slag exceed the leaching standard of inert waste (Loncnar et al., 2016). Cupola Furnace Slag: Its Origin, Properties and Utilization

A cupola furnace is the most frequently used furnace aggregate for cast iron production. A by-product of the production of cast iron in cupola furnaces is cupola slag. Its amount is 40–80 kg per 1 tonne of the produced cast iron, and that is one of the reasons why this material is not as favoured as, for example, the blast-furnace slag. The …

Induction Furnace Cooling Systems

A closed loop dry air cooler system is now the standard for most induction furnace manufacturers. However, other systems that use evaporative coolers or separate coolers for the power supply and furnaces do exist.
